My 1996 toyota tacoma will not start. have battery power. no turnover when turning the key to start

Do the headlamps shine bright ? Dash lights come on when you turn the key to the run position ? You don't hear the starter solenoid click when trying to start it ? What do you mean by you have batt power ? Lights work ? If so I would check the starter relay , In the fuse box under the hood if there is one . I'm looking at a working diagram an it doesn't say where it is located . The head lamps wouldn't work if it had bad battery cables . You could da a voltage drop test on starter circuit . If you are absolutely certain that the battery is ok and charged, check the cables for tightness and corrosion - particularly the black earth cable where it attaches to the engine block/bodywork. Undo the bolts slightly and retighten ..

Before you try anything, can you get a neighbour or friend to boost start/jump start your car?

If it starts ok .. that tells you the starter motor is ok .. and the problem lies with your battery/leads

It does not click turnover or start.. The battery has just been replaced..

you need to check the main fuse should be either on battery cable or in fuze box under hood sounds like it blew if not see if have any power in car dome lights w.e. if so check and make sure the 3 wires on the starter are not loose and clean hope this helps

2002 3.4L toyota tacoma won't start. there is power to the radio and lights, but when i turn the key there's nothing, no noise; the radio flashes off as normal.

check battery ground for loose fitting, check fuse & relay,check voltage going to starter, check battery condition
